If you need to have the Internet, make sure you take the tax deduction for this expense. A percentage of the cost of the service can be deducted from your earnings, though you can't claim more than half the cost if it's being used by you or a family member for non-business purposes. When you are thinking of starting a home business and are currently employed, do not quit your job just yet. Chances are that your new business will not bring in a profit for quite a while, and it is best to have regular income from your current job during that time. It is also sensible to have six months of living expenses in savings. Take short breaks during the day and avoid getting too absorbed in household personal activities. If you want to begin a home-based business, but aren't sure what kind to begin, try looking online to see which ones work. However, be aware of the many home business scams advertised on the Internet. Some websites sell information that can be gained elsewhere for free, or offer pricey courses on basic techniques. There are those tricky scams as well that take your money for various things. If it's something that sounds too good, it most probably is.
